编辑类似字符串的最佳方法是什么?

时间:2010-12-12 21:26:50

标签: vim

我需要做下一个任务:

档案:

string1 data1 data

我需要创建更多字符串,只需更改数字

string2 data2 data
string3 data3 data
string4 data4 data

我怎么能快速做到?

2 个答案:

答案 0 :(得分:8)

选择该输入行,将其拉入缓冲区a:"ayy

然后记录以下序列:qq

  1. "ap粘贴下面的一行
  2. ctrl-a增加数字
  3. w前进一个字
  4. ctrl-a增加数字
  5. "ayy将此行作为新基线
  6. 使用q

    结束您的宏

    然后根据需要重复多次(假设为42),42@q

答案 1 :(得分:3)

多个插件管理:visincr.vim,increment.vim。

我使用visincr,这非常简单:Visual block,:I